Theopoetics: A Language of Wander & Wonder is a Theopoetic and interdisciplinary exploration of how we speak about God, life, and meaning in a world that resists certainty. Moving beyond rigid doctrine and purely analytical theology, this work reclaims language as a living, imaginative, and deeply human response to the Divine.
At its core, this audiobook argues that theology is not merely something we think—it is something we feel, speak, imagine, and live.
Rooted in both scholarly insight and lived experience, Theopoetics becomes a practice: a way of engaging the world that honors doubt, embraces beauty, resists reduction, and remains open to transformation.
Theopoetics: A Language of Wander & Wonder invites listeners into a different kind of theological discourse—one that does not seek to resolve mystery, but to dwell within it. It is an audiobook for seekers, thinkers, creatives, and anyone longing for a language of faith that remains honest, expansive, and alive.
